AM: the ministry is doing its utmost for the competitiveness of the egg, vegetable and fruit sectors
The state’s margin of maneuver is influenced by Hungarian and EU legislation when influencing market processes, while the Ministry of Agriculture (AM) makes use of all possibilities and grabs all means to ensure the competitiveness of livestock farmers and vegetable and fruit growers operating in the Hungarian egg sector – Farkas Sándor, Parliamentary Minister of State wrote in a written reply to a parliamentary question on Wednesday.
The Minister of State responded to Gyöngyösi Márton (Jobbik), who asked, what measures of the ministry would help producers and buyers, because egg, potatoe, and fresh vegetable prices have risen dramatically. (MTI)
